Functional movement screening fms is advocated as a practical and objective tool to assess the fundamental movement characteristics of athletes. Functional movement fms 2s and 3s only basic motor control move to fitness and performance testing dysfunctional movement fms 1 correction focus on mobility and stability issues within 1 pattern movement health problem fms 0 assess for diagnosis in the 0 pattern 16. The functional movement screen fms 12, and later the selective functional movement assessment sfma3, was developed to help clinicians and health care professions screen individuals for risk of injury and or a dysfunctional or performancelimiting movement pattern.
